Google is seeking a Software Engineering Manager to lead their Systems Acceleration team in Silicon development. This role combines technical expertise with leadership responsibilities, focusing on software power and performance optimization for SoCs. The position requires collaboration with cross-functional teams and oversight of large-scale projects.
The ideal candidate will bring deep technical knowledge in hardware acceleration and software optimization, along with proven leadership experience. You'll be working at the intersection of hardware and software, optimizing production software for Google's custom SoCs and contributing to future architecture designs.
This role offers the opportunity to work on cutting-edge technology at one of the world's leading tech companies. You'll be part of Google's mission to create radically helpful experiences through the combination of AI, software, and hardware. The position involves working with teams across various regions, making English fluency essential.
Key technical areas include C/C++ development, hardware accelerators (GPU, TPU, DSP), power and performance optimization, and mobile SoC architecture. Leadership responsibilities include managing engineers across multiple teams and locations, overseeing project deployments, and contributing to product strategy.
The role is based in New Taipei, Taiwan, where you'll work with Google's hardware and software teams to push the boundaries of computing performance. This is an excellent opportunity for someone who combines technical depth with leadership abilities and wants to impact billions of users through Google's hardware initiatives.